Cathy Watson Genna reminds us of the MAIN collaborative trial (430 women)
that got the same results as Midwife Jo Alexander did in her study (96
women) : giving women things to do in pregnancy didn't work, and undermined
breastfeeding.
Babies don't need nipples to breastfeed. A newborn can suck a nipple out of
your cheek. Babies need unrestricted skin to skin in the first 3 days to get
lots of practice with soft breasts before the milk volume increases.
